+/* Note: contrary to its documentation, ntfs_attr_pwrite() can return a short
+ * count in non-error cases --- specifically, when writing to a compressed
+ * attribute and the requested count exceeds the size of an NTFS "compression
+ * block". Therefore, we must continue calling ntfs_attr_pwrite() until all
+ * bytes have been written or a real error has occurred. */
+static bool
+ntfs_3g_full_pwrite(ntfs_attr *na, u64 offset, size_t size, const u8 *data)
+{
+ while (size) {
+ s64 res = ntfs_attr_pwrite(na, offset, size, data);
+ if (unlikely(res <= 0))
+ return false;
+ wimlib_assert(res <= size);
+ offset += res;
+ size -= res;
+ data += res;
+ }
+ return true;
+}
